About 3-[[3-[[4-[2-(2-aminoethylamino)-4-pyridinyl]-1,3,5-triazin-2-yl]amino]phenyl]methyl-methylamino]prop-1-en-2-ol

3-[[3-[[4-[2-(2-aminoethylamino)-4-pyridinyl]-1,3,5-triazin-2-yl]amino]phenyl]methyl-methylamino]prop-1-en-2-ol (PubChem CID 143387553) has the molecular formula C21H26N8O and a molecular weight of 406.49 g/mol. Its IUPAC name is 3-[[3-[[4-[2-(2-aminoethylamino)-4-pyridinyl]-1,3,5-triazin-2-yl]amino]phenyl]methyl-methylamino]prop-1-en-2-ol.
